Tariki-2C March-April 1999 Well Test Analysis

Login to download

This report presents the analysis of the pressure transients previous measurements made in July and August 1998. The results are compared with those reported by SSI in November 1998 and indicate that the well is located in a closed reservoir compartment that has depleted by approximately 75.4 bar since production started. The pore volume is estimated to be 556,000 m3 which, assuming a 15% water saturation, and no oil water contact within the compartment, corresponds to 297,000 Sm3 (1.87 million St) of oil initially in place.
